The answer to 'best roof repair' is to hire a professional roofing contractor. Roof repairs can be complex and dangerous, especially for homeowners without the proper tools, equipment, and expertise. A qualified roofer will be able to accurately diagnose the issue, provide the best solution, and complete the repair safely and to industry standards.
Professional roofers have the training and experience to handle a wide range of roof repair needs, from fixing leaks and replacing damaged shingles to addressing structural issues. They also have access to high-quality roofing materials and can ensure the repair blends seamlessly with the rest of your roof. Attempting DIY roof repairs can lead to further damage, safety hazards, and costly mistakes down the line.